sp1000
02-01-2008, 07:39
با سلام
من در برنامه ام از دو تا ADdoQuery استفاده کرده ام که هر دوی آنها به یک جدول اکسس وصل هستند
یکی را برای ثبت اطلاعات قرار داده ام و دیگری را برای چستجو .
برنامه ام را طوری نوشته ام که اگر کسی بخواد اطلاعات تکراری وارد برنامه کنه برنامه به کاربر پیغام بده
حالا یه مشکلی دارم واون اینکه من اطلاعاتی را وارد میکنم سپس ثبت می کنم دوباره ویرایش میکنم و ثبت میکنم و در مرتبه سوم وقتی اطلاعات اولی را وارد میکنم برنامه به من پیغام میده در صورتی که اصلا چنین اطلاعاتی وجود ندارد
بزارید با یک مثال واضح تر بیان کنم
ببینید
من مثلا شماره 1 را وارد میکنم وبرنامه بدون دادن پیغام به من اجازه ثبت میده حالا من پس از ثبت دوباره ویرایش میکنم یعنی 1 را به 2 تغییر میدهم با زهم برنامه بدون دادن پیغام اطلاعاتم رو ثبت میکنه و لی در مرتبه سوم وقتی می خوام ویرایش کنم عدد 1 را وارد میکنم برنامه به من پیغام میده در صورتیکه اصلا عدد 1 در برنامه نیست
من مشکلش را پیدا کرد این هستش
جدولی را که برای جستجو قرار داده ام یا جدولی که برای ثبت قرار داده ام هم خوانی ندارند یعنی با هم همتراز نمی شوند واضح تر بگم جدول جستجوی من اطلاعات را آبدیت نمیکنه و چون اطلاعات قبلی توش مونده بر اساس همون اطلاعات به من پیغام میده
حال میخواستم بدونم آیا راهی هست که بشه یه جدولی آبدیت کرد
از کدهای Refresh , Ubdait هم استفاده کردم ولی نشد
میشه لطفا راهنمایی کنید
ممنون
بای
من در برنامه ام از دو تا ADdoQuery استفاده کرده ام که هر دوی آنها به یک جدول اکسس وصل هستند
یکی را برای ثبت اطلاعات قرار داده ام و دیگری را برای چستجو .
برنامه ام را طوری نوشته ام که اگر کسی بخواد اطلاعات تکراری وارد برنامه کنه برنامه به کاربر پیغام بده
حالا یه مشکلی دارم واون اینکه من اطلاعاتی را وارد میکنم سپس ثبت می کنم دوباره ویرایش میکنم و ثبت میکنم و در مرتبه سوم وقتی اطلاعات اولی را وارد میکنم برنامه به من پیغام میده در صورتی که اصلا چنین اطلاعاتی وجود ندارد
بزارید با یک مثال واضح تر بیان کنم
ببینید
من مثلا شماره 1 را وارد میکنم وبرنامه بدون دادن پیغام به من اجازه ثبت میده حالا من پس از ثبت دوباره ویرایش میکنم یعنی 1 را به 2 تغییر میدهم با زهم برنامه بدون دادن پیغام اطلاعاتم رو ثبت میکنه و لی در مرتبه سوم وقتی می خوام ویرایش کنم عدد 1 را وارد میکنم برنامه به من پیغام میده در صورتیکه اصلا عدد 1 در برنامه نیست
من مشکلش را پیدا کرد این هستش
جدولی را که برای جستجو قرار داده ام یا جدولی که برای ثبت قرار داده ام هم خوانی ندارند یعنی با هم همتراز نمی شوند واضح تر بگم جدول جستجوی من اطلاعات را آبدیت نمیکنه و چون اطلاعات قبلی توش مونده بر اساس همون اطلاعات به من پیغام میده
حال میخواستم بدونم آیا راهی هست که بشه یه جدولی آبدیت کرد
از کدهای Refresh , Ubdait هم استفاده کردم ولی نشد
میشه لطفا راهنمایی کنید
ممنون
بای